Raytheon Co.’s Marlborough operations inked a $12.5 million deal with a Pennsylvania power company to provide a radio and communications system across a 30,000-square-mile service area in West Virginia, western Pennsylvania and parts of Maryland.
Raytheon will install its P25 digital land radio system for Allegheny Power. The system will provide better frequency and reliability to the company’s service area and will bring it into compliance with Federal Communications Commission regulations.
Allegheny has about 800 workers and serves about 1.5 million customers.
